Margaret Donato, 90, of Hyde Park, passed away peacefully at home, surrounded by family, on November 27, 2020, after a battle with cancer. Margaret was predeceased by her beloved husband, Domenic Donato and her son James Donato. Margaret is survived by her siblings Theresa Geraghty, Ina McGrenery, and John Cooke; by her daughter, Anne Paul as well as her grandchildren, Robin Lucius and her husband Robert, Melissa Burgess, Rebecca and Robert Long; Patrick Donato; Michael Donato and Christine; Jenny and Matt Poisson, great grandchildren Sarah, Zachary, Aydan, Lexi, Gabrielle, Christopher, and Charlotte, Patrick, Alexandria, and nieces and nephews in Ireland.
Margaret was born in Galway, Ireland and emigrated to America (Boston, MA) in 1961. She eventually settled into Hyde Park after marrying Domenic, the love of her life. Over the years, they would often travel back to Ireland. Margaret will be remembered for her endless love, sense of humor, great intelligence, independence, and profound faith in God.
